What are trapezoids and Rhombuses?

A trapezoid is a polygon that has only one pair of parallel sides. These parallel sides are also called parallel bases of trapezoid. The other two sides of trapezoids are non-parallel and called legs of trapezoids.

A rhombus is a special case of a parallelogram. In a rhombus, opposite sides are parallel and the opposite angles are equal. Moreover, all the sides of a rhombus are equal in length, and the diagonals bisect each other at right angles. The rhombus is also called a diamond or rhombus diamond.

We know that if (h, k) represents the coordinate of the center of circle and r is the radius of the circle then the equation of circle is given by:

[tex](x-h)^2+(y-k)^2=r^2[/tex]

Here we have:

[tex]h=0\ ,\ k=0\ and\ r=10[/tex]

Hence, the equation of circle is given by:

[tex](x-0)^2+(y-0)^2=10^2\\\\i.e.\\\\x^2+y^2=100------------(1)[/tex]

If we substitute the given point into the equation of the circle and it makes the equation true then the point lie on the circle and if it doesn't make the equation true then the point do not lie on the circle.
